Originally Posted by Instigator
You are right. And I would mount it where exactly? I am keeping AC and have a huge front sway bar. In front of the radiator and/or hacking my front end is out of the question.
I like the "made-for-my-application" ICs because they mount out of the way of everthing and I am pretty sure that Procharger has done some pretty extensive testing on them for this kit. If my IATs are higher than wanted then I'll just mount some small fans on the tops of them.
From the research I did Procharger didn't too much research on twin 4.5's and the larger F1A head unit. The F-Body kit they have was designed around the P1 and then eventually the D1. The twin 4.5's are even limited to the D1 when spun hard on pump gas.

You gotta wonder after alot of driving around and heat soaking where those IAT's will end up at....dyno pulls and sustained street driving are two different animals. Bob at EPP has a nice affordable FMIC kit. Check it out.

Nonetheless, your combo, if held in moderation, will be a fun street car with plenty of power.

Originally Posted by ChevyChad
You can always put a meth kit on if you are getting high IAT's. I'm also curious as to what your power goals are?
The meth will only take you so far with a setup like this.

It would allmost be worth it to run one of those interceptor gauges that you can monitor pids such as inlet air temp.

You mentioned the 3.90 pulley? We are running that with the shop car and see around 18psi of boost, we spin around 6800ish.

WITH a front mount intercooler we are seeing IAT's around 130ish on the big end of the track, we run racefuel and no meth.
